Brazilian Jiu Jitsu: The Art of Submission

Brazilian Jiu Jitsu has become a highly effective martial art recognized for its emphasis on leverage and technique over brute strength. Practitioners learn a wide selection of grappling techniques, allowing them to control larger opponents. BJJ champions thrive through strategic positioning, ground submissions, and precise takedowns. It's a dynamic art form that requires both physical and mental discipline.

Choosing the Right Gi for You

Stepping onto the mats for the first instance? Picking the ideal gi can sound overwhelming. But don't worry, we've got your back! A good gi is a fundamental part of your jiu jitsu journey, offering both comfort and functionality.

First, consider the style of training you'll be doing in. Competition gis are usually lighter weight and made for a more agile style. Training gis on the other aspect tend to be heavier, with added strength.

Next, think about your measurements. A gi that is too tight will limit your movement, while one that is too loose can get in the way. Finally, the best gi for you will be comfortable. Take your time to try on different gis and find the one that feels ideal for you!
